Invest Victoria

Logo for Invest Victoria

Invest Victoria is the Victorian Government's investment attraction agency, fostering long term economic prosperity by enabling business opportunities and job creation for Victoria.

Invest Victoria offers investors a range of free and confidential professional services and support through their global network.
